Victoria bans mobile phones at schools

Victoria is cracking down on students using phones at state-run schools. It's the first state to launch a blanket ban for both primary and secondary schools. And if the federal government has its way - all other states and territories will soon follow suit. (AUDIO IN TURKISH)
